Abstract
The utility model discloses a deep drawing die for a bottom shell of an electric water heater. The deep drawing die comprises an upper die holder, an upper die, a lower die holder, a lower die, a blank holder, an ejector rod, an elastic device and a guide post, wherein the upper die is fixedly arranged at the bottom of the upper die holder, the lower die is fixedly arranged at the top of the lower die holder, the upper die is vertically opposite to the lower die, the bottom surface of the upper die is an upper profile, the top surface of the lower die is a lower profile, and the blank holder is sleeved on the outer side of the lower die and slidably connected to the lower die holder in a vertical single degree of freedom manner. When the blank holder is positioned at a lower dead point, the top surface of the blank holder is linked with the lower profile by means of transition. The ejector rod penetrates through the lower die holder and is perpendicularly supported at the bottom of the blank holder, the elastic device is connected to the ejector rod and used for providing upward elastic force for the blank holder through the ejector rod, and the guide post is arranged between the upper die holder and the lower die holder and used for ensuring the horizontal relative positions of the upper die holder and the lower die holder. By the aid of the deep drawing die for the bottom shell of the electric water heater, a workpiece can be pressed and positioned during punching to uniformly deform without wrinkling, a blank can be ejected after forming, the workpiece is easy to take, production efficiency can be improved, rejection rate is decreased, and the labor intensity of workers is reduced.
